U+1FD8 "" Greek Capital Letter Iota with Vrachy is a precomposed character in the Greek and Coptic block, representing a capital iota with a breve mark above it, known as a vrachy. This diacritical combination denotes a short vowel sound in ancient Greek and is primarily used in scholarly or liturgical contexts for the accurate transcription of classical texts. It is rarely employed in modern Greek writing, where the simplified monotonic system omits such accentuation.
